Scorpion
Originally released in 1997. Scorpion is a action film. directed by Behruz Afkhami.
Starring Jamshid Hashempour, Mohammad Saleh Ala, and Atila Pesyani
Synopsis
Drug and arms smugglers in Baluchistan region, through one of their leaders, ask the Captain of the Police "Mansour Yekke Taz" to allow their cargo to pass through the region in exchange for receiving a huge amount of dollars, Captain Yekke Taz agrees and after receiving the money On the promised day, he attacks the smuggling convoy with all his might and arrests them. The smugglers kill Captain in retaliation for this act.
